Richard Woodbridge to step down as Chairman at the end of the season

It was announced today by the club that Richard Woodbridge will step aside as chairman at the end of the current campaign.

Therefore as a result the club will be appointing a new chairman for the 2017/18 season. He will continue as a committee member within the club, and will continue to chair the 'Steyning Community Hub Ltd' which operates the new 3G facility at the club.

Woodbridge said today " It has been incredibly hard coming to this decision as the club is now in my blood, however I know it is the right decision. After 7 years of really hard work it is time to take a step back. My commitments away from the club are significant and it is time to focus on these more. I will remain as a dedicated committee member and am very keen to see the club continue moving forward. I am keen to help transform the Shooting Field further in to a first class facility and to watch successful football across all the age groups"

The club now operates with a strong committee of talented and dedicated people and is confident it will be business as usual when the new chairman is appointed. Moves are already underway to secure the right appointment.

Woodbridge added " The new chairman will inherit a strong committee , as well as some fantastic volunteers who make the place tick. When they come in with fresh ideas and hopefully change a few things, that can only benefit the club. I am really proud of what the committees past and present have achieved over the past 7 years. The highlights for me are the coming together of Steyning Strikers and Steyning Town to form one club, some fantastic social events and tournaments, clearing nearly £30,000 of debt and of course the installation of our fantastic 3G facility. With the solid building blocks in place I feel that success on the field is just around the corner, and the near future is very exciting right across the club".
